VEHICLE / PRIVATE BUS PASSES
$108 - $308 (one per vehicle)
Every Vehicle/ Private Bus (including taxis/ drop-offs) must purchase a pass to offset carbon emissions with TREECREDS. All passes include a FREE drug/alcohol test & rubbish bags.
Thursday Access Passes allow you (and any one in your vehicle with a valid Festival Ticket) to enter the site from 2pm Thursday and enjoy an extra night of music, art and dips in the Murray.
Friday Passes allow access from Friday 12pm.
1x Vehicle pass is required per vehicle and allows every individual in that vehicle entry if they have a valid Festival Ticket in their name.Vehicle Passes = Cars (8 seats or less) / caravans/ campervans / motorbikes + trailers
Private Mini Bus = Buses you charter privately (24 seats or less)
Large Private Bus = Buses you charter privately (50 seats or less)You can hire your own private bus with our friends at COACH HIRE. Don’t forget you will also need a private bus pass to enter the site.
Vehicle / Private Bus Passes do NOT include Festival Tickets and these must be purchased separately.

SF SHUTTLE & PUBLIC TRANSPORT
$0 - $12 (return)
If you’re an absolute legend and choose to take public transport to Strawberry you can hop on the SF Shuttle Bus to the festival for FREE. Simply pre-book via Humanitix and have your PT ticket handy to board the bus.
Locals can also hop on the SF Shuttle for free by showing their driving license with Berrigan Shire postcode.
The SF Shuttle will run Thursday - Sunday to/from Tocumwal for those looking to buy extra essentials, snacks and alcohol.
Please only pre-book the shuttle (Thurs/Fri) if you are definitely going to be utilising the service, so that seats are available for locals and those taking PT who need them. Bookings will open after the Limited Public Sale.

Yes the below restrictions apply.
Pack smart and light.
There will be only enough room for one large suitcase + one standard backpack OR the equivalent amount of luggage per person on the bus. We understand you may need to bring camping gear, but please do your best to pack smart and light within the volumes provided.
Alcohol limits: 2x six packs (12 cans of beer, cider or premixed) OR a 2L cask of wine per person.
Trolleys must be folded flat to be stored in the bus luggage compartment.
Strictly No Gazebos, No Glass, No NOS, No illegal substances. Banned items will be confiscated.
Be smart and label your luggage!
Consider camping rentals, Glamping & Pre-pitched camping and packing together as a group if travelling with friends.
Please do not over pack as this can cause delays if buses cannot fit your luggage in the hold. -
